Every time celebs had to get surgeries done after accidents while shooting

international media news
August 29, 2021 241 Views0

A couple of days ago, fans were left worried when reports began doing the rounds that Abhishek Bachchan has been admitted to a hospital and will be undergoing surgery. Get well wishes soon started pouring in for the actor when Amitabh Bachchan and sister Shweta were snapped at the hospital too. It was later revealed that the younger Bachchan suffered an accident while shooting for his next film in Chennai. 

But not just Abhishek, numerous actors in the past have also suffered accidents on the sets of their film post which they had to get surgery done. From Amitabh Bachchan to Hrithik Roshan – check it out here.  

Abhishek Bachchan

The actor was busy shooting for a film in Chennai. But due to a freak accident on the sets of the film, the actor flew down to Mumbai, got an emergency surgery done to fix his hand, and was back to Chennai to resume shooting. Sharing a picture, AB Jr wrote, “Had a freak accident in Chennai on the set of my new film last Wednesday. Fractured my right hand. Needed surgery to fix it! So a quick trip back home to Mumbai. Surgery done, all patched-up and casted. And now back in Chennai to resume work. As they say… The show must go on! And as my father said…. Mard ko dard nahin hota! Ok, ok, ok it hurt a little. Thank you all for your wishes and get-well-soon messages.”

Amitabh Bachchan

Many, many years before AB Jr’s accident, his superstar father Big B suffered a fatal accident on the sets of his 1983 film Coolie. He was rushed to the hospital and had to undergo surgeries. Post that, his battle to complete recovery was also very long. The actor was shooting in Bangalore University campus with Puneet Issar for a fight scene when the accident occurs. 

Shah Rukh Khan 

SRK has been spotted with an arm cast on various occasions. But while filming for Happy New Year in Juhu’s JW Mariott, a door fell on his arm and he was rushed to the nearby Nanavati Hospital after the arm began bleeding. But even before this, SRK got injured while shooting for Chennai Express. He then took off to London to undergo surgery. 

Hrithik Roshan 

Bollywood’s beloved Duggu suffered a head injury while shooting for Bang Bang. Despite the injury, Hrithik completed shooting for the film and was later admitted to the hospital to undergo surgery for subdural hematoma (blood clot). The actor was also earlier injured while shooting for Agneepath. His father Rakesh Roshan had later told PTI, “He is doing fine now. He has been shifted to a room and will be discharged in two days.”

John Abraham 

John was shooting for high-octane action sequences for Force 2. During one such scene, he injured his knee and suffered a blood clot that had to surgically be removed.
